TAOS Data
用户8056
添加快捷方式
分享
TDengine IDMP 应用场景:长输管道站场-压气站
输入“/”快速插入内容
TDengine
IDMP
应用场景:长输管道站场
-
压气站
用户8056
用户8056
用户2033
用户2033
2025年11月18日修改
1.
场景模拟
https://www.cnpc.com.cn/syzs/mcjs/202502/a73de6ac3a1b46508f89d1d8e93d460c.shtml
输油气站场是长输油气管道系统中各类工艺站场的总称。长输油气管道埋在地下,但每隔一段距离就会在地面设置一个输油气站场,绵延数百、数千甚至上万千米的地下管道,依靠这些设置在地面上的输油气站场首尾相接而成,类似于人体的“关节”将人体各个部位连接在一起一样,所以站场是长输油气管道系统不可或缺的组成部分。管道之所以能够源源不断地输送石油和天然气,就是因为站场为之配套了动力、热力、储存、分输等功能以及各种安全保障措施。
本文模拟其中一种典型的输油气站场:压气站。
参考如下文章介绍的工艺流程,模拟一个简易的模型,并使用 Python 生成模拟数据。
https://www.doc88.com/p-1416819937998.html
数据集说明如下:
数据集模拟生成脚本:
compressor_station_data.py
运行 Python 脚本,生成:
•
数据集:
CompressorStation.csv
•
数据字典(供参考):
CompressorStation_dictionary.csv
2.
前提条件
•
已安装 TDengine TSDB + IDMP。本示例已采用 Docker Compose 方式快速部署,TSDB 版本 3.3.8.1,IDMP 版本 1.0.5.1。
•
KEPServer 环境已具备。本示例 KEPServer 服务在宿主机,服务地址是
host.docker.internal:49320
。
3.
场景快速搭建
3.1
KEPServer 配置 OPC 数据源
在系统中新建 ODBC 数据源
CSV_CS
,选择驱动
Microsoft Text Driver (*.txt; *.csv)
,选择数据集所在的目录。注意需为“系统 DSN”。
在 KEPServer 添加通道
压气站Demo
,
Advanced Simulator
驱动,【Data Source】选
CSV_CS
54%
46%
添加设备
压气站
,选择对应的数据集
CompressorStation.csv
,【Record Selection Interval】设置为
5000ms
。
33%
67%